InstallatIon ConsIderatIons
The12SeriesEqualizersaredesignedfornominal+4dBulevels.Theequalizerscanbe
usedwitheitherbalancedorunbalancedsources,andtheoutputscanbeusedwitheitherbalancedorunbalanced
loads,providedthepropercablingisused.
A balanced line is defined as two-conductor shielded cable with the two center conductors carrying the same signal
but of opposite polarity when referenced to ground. An unbalanced line is generally a single-conductor shielded
cable with the center conductor carrying the signal and the shield at ground potential.
Theequalizerhasaninputimpedanceof40kbalancedand20k unbalanced. This
makes the 12 Series Equalizers’ audio inputs suitable for use with virtually any low source impedance (under 2k).
Theequalizer’soutputiscapableofdrivinga600loadto+18dBu.Formaximum
humrejectionwithabalancedsource,avoidcommongroundingattheequalizer’sinputsandoutputs.Mostbal-
anced(3-conductor)cableshavetheshieldconnectedatbothends.Thiscanresultingroundloopswhichcause
hum.Ifhumpersiststrydisconnectingtheshieldononeormoreofthecablesinthesystem,preferablyattheinput
ofadevice,notattheoutput.
operatIon and applICatIon notes
Thedbx12SeriesGraphicEqualizersareusefulaudiosignalprocessingtoolsinsituationswhereprecisefrequency
control is required across the audible frequency spectrum.
When used with an audio spectrum analyzer the EQs can tune any acoustical environment -- from the studio to the
concerthall--tostopringing,increaseclarity,andflattentheoverallfrequencyresponseoftheenvironment.A
real-time spectrum analyzer or other types of audio environment analyzers are very useful in determining the
amount of equalization needed.
Insertthegraphicequalizerbetweenthesignalsource(usuallyamixer)andthepoweramplifiers(orthecrossoverif
thereisone).Adjustthelevelandequalizationasrequiredtoyieldthedesiredsystemresponse.Thelongthrowfad-
ers of the EQs allow very precise settings of the equalization for accurate equalization curves.
Foroptimumsignal-to-noiseresponse,thegainstructureofthesoundsystemmustbeproperlysetup.Eachcompo-
nentofthesoundsystemshouldbesetatitsnominaloperatinglevel,startingwiththefirstelementinthesystem,
usually a mixing console. Each element should be run at its nominal operating level in order to take advantage of
themaximumsignal-to-noisepropertiesofthatelement.Loudspeakeramplifiers,asthelastelementinthechain,
shouldbesetonlyasloudasnecessary,inordertoavoidinducingunnecessarynoiseintothesystem.
